Understanding the Significance of Raii-Iess Mounts in Solar Bracket Applications

In the fast-evolving world of solar energy, the significance of effective mounting systems cannot be overstated. One such innovative solution is the raii-iess mount, which has become increasingly popular in the field of solar bracket applications. These mounts offer a plethora of advantages that contribute to the overall performance and reliability of photovoltaic systems.
Raii-iess mounts are designed to simplify the installation process while ensuring robust support for solar panels. Traditionally, mounting systems required intricate rail assemblies, which could complicate installation and increase the potential for errors. Raii-iess mounts eliminate the need for these rails, allowing for a more streamlined setup. This is particularly beneficial in industrial applications where time efficiency is crucial.
One of the primary benefits of raii-iess mounts is their ability to reduce material usage. By eliminating rails, manufacturers can lower the overall weight of the mounting system, which in turn minimizes the structural load on rooftops or ground installations. This characteristic not only enhances the installation's safety but also leads to cost savings in terms of both materials and labor.
Moreover, raii-iess mounts are engineered to withstand various environmental factors. Their design often incorporates features that enhance durability and resistance to corrosion, making them suitable for diverse climates. This resilience extends the lifespan of solar installations and ensures consistent energy generation over time, which is essential for maximizing return on investment in solar technology.
In terms of adaptability, raii-iess mounts can be employed in various configurations, accommodating different panel sizes and orientations. This flexibility makes them a preferred choice among solar developers seeking customized solutions that can meet specific site requirements. By facilitating optimal angle adjustments, these mounts help in maximizing solar exposure, thereby boosting energy efficiency.
Additionally, the integration of raii-iess mounts into solar projects aligns with the overall trend towards sustainability and eco-friendliness. By streamlining the installation process and reducing material waste, these mounts contribute to a lower carbon footprint associated with solar energy deployment.
In conclusion, the adoption of raii-iess mounts in photovoltaic bracket applications represents a significant advancement in the design and functionality of solar mounting systems. Their ease of installation, material efficiency, durability, and adaptability make them a valuable component in the growing field of renewable energy. As the industry continues to innovate, understanding the role and benefits of raii-iess mounts will be crucial for professionals looking to optimize solar installations. By leveraging such technologies, businesses can not only enhance their operational efficiency but also contribute to a more sustainable future.
